Sheridan 51, Catholic 36
Week 7- LITTLE ROCK — Sheridan seized an early lead and answered every Catholic surge to win 51–36 on Friday at War Memorial Stadium. The Yellowjackets opened with two first‑quarter rushing scores, then leaned on their perimeter passing to stay in front, finishing with seven touchdowns on the night. WR Dylan Smith hauled in three TDs, all from sophomore QB Easton Barksdale, while junior RB Zay Stephens provided the balance Sheridan needed on the ground.
Catholic quarterback Phillips Blair willed the Rockets back into it, accounting for five total touchdowns—two keepers and three strikes to senior Hayden Roaf—to pull within 37–28 early in the fourth quarter. Junior Hunter Markhamconverted two two‑point plays, including a heads‑up scramble on a bobbled PAT, as Catholic capitalized on field position and a late onside recovery to apply pressure. Defensively, seniors Aiden Gaiser and Sawyer Bagby produced timely stops, and Evan Scott forced a fumble that CB Walter Menefee recovered to halt a red‑zone drive just before halftime.
Sheridan answered, though. Barksdale found Smith again to restore a two‑score cushion, and senior RB/TE Eli Turnerpowered in late to put the game out of reach. The Yellowjackets’ commitment to tempo and aggressive conversions—mixing kicks with two‑point tries—kept Catholic chasing the number the rest of the way. Sheridan improves its playoff outlook with a road win over a Catholic roster headlined by Blair (Jr., QB) and Roaf (Sr., CB/FS), while the Rockets showed resilience that should carry into the stretch run.
Scoring Summary- WATCH HIGHLIGHTS
1st Quarter
Sheridan – Zay Stephens run (PAT good), SHER 7–0.
Catholic – Phillips Blair 5 run (Linkoln Perez kick), 7–7.
Sheridan – Stephens run (2‑pt good), SHER 15–7.
Sheridan – Walker Shields pass from Easton Barksdale (2‑pt good), SHER 23–7.
2nd Quarter
Catholic – Blair run (2‑pt no good), SHER 23–13.
Sheridan – Dylan Smith pass from Barksdale (PAT good), SHER 30–13.
3rd Quarter
Catholic – Roaf pass from Blair (Perez kick), SHER 30–20.
Sheridan – Smith pass from Barksdale (PAT good), SHER 37–20.
4th Quarter
Catholic – Roaf pass from Blair (Markham 2‑pt run), SHER 37–28.
Sheridan – Smith pass from Barksdale (PAT no good), SHER 43–28.
Sheridan – Eli Turner run (2‑pt good), SHER 51–28.
Catholic – Roaf pass from Blair (Blair to Markham 2‑pt pass), Final 51–36.
